JUSTICE WARD delivered the opinion of the court:
The claimant, Larry S. Laker, filed an application for adjustment of claim under the Workers' Compensation Act (Ill. Rev. Stat. 1979, ch. 48, par. 138.1 et seq.) to recover benefits for the loss of use of the left eye.
